MAGISTRATO (2.55 Wetherby, nap)

Can land a fab four-timer. Deborah Cole’s chaser has been in amazing form on his past three starts, winning by a total of 58 lengths and he was eased down here last time by champion jockey Sean Bowen who stays on board. This is slightly tougher company but trip and track are ideal and he’ll be hard to stop in his current mood.

CAPTAIN COOL (4.05 Wetherby, nb)

He has taken a big step forward since moving into handicap hurdles at Sedgefield. He was a close second there last month before more than matching that effort to win 23 days ago. He stays well at that tough track so should have no issue stepping up in trip from a fair 5lb higher in the weights.

PRINCLING (1.10 Newmarket, treble)

Went down in a head-bobber on debut at Kempton 18 days ago. That was a really promising start from William Haggas’ son of Kingman who looks certain to take a big step forward. This looks a decent contest and he can come out on top.
